Aufzeichnen der Datenbankabfragen und Objektaktionen
Nutzen Sie im System Debugger die Aufzeichnung der Datenbankabfragen und Objektaktionen für die Fehlersuche und die Optimierung der Skripte während der Entwicklung. Aufgezeichnet werden die Ausführungszeit und das ausgeführte Kommando.
Tabelle 142: Funktionen für die Aufzeichnung von Datenbankabfragen und Objektaktionen
|
Die Aufzeichnung wird gestartet. |
|
Die Aufzeichnung wird gestoppt. |
|
Die Aufzeichnungen werden in die Zwischenablage kopiert. |
|
Die Aufzeichnungen werden in einer Datei gespeichert. |
|
Die Aufzeichnungen werden gelöscht. |
Testen von Skriptcode im System Debugger
Mit dem System Debugger haben Sie die Möglichkeit Skripte, Bildungsregeln, Formatierungsskripte, Methoden und Tabellenskripte zu testen. Es stehen Ihnen hier die Debug- und Bearbeitungsmöglichkeiten des Visual Studio zur Verfügung.
Detaillierte Informationen zum Thema
Skripte im System Debugger testen
Um ein Skript zu testen
-
Wählen Sie im System Debugger im Bereich Skripte das Skript aus.
-
Sofern erforderlich, geben Sie die Werte für die Parameter des Skriptes an.
-
Prüfen Sie die Optionen für die Ausführung des Skriptes.
-
Debug Methode verwenden: Es wird in den Quellcode gesprungen. Somit können alle Debug-Möglichkeiten des Visual Studio genutzt werden.
-
Base Eigenschaften definieren: Die Variablen Base und Value der Skript-Basisklasse können als Eingabeparameter vorbelegt werden, um im Skript damit zu arbeiten.
Beispiel:
Base wird mit einem DB-Object-Key initialisiert um base.GetValue("SpaltenName").String zu verwenden.
-
Transaktion mit Rollback: Mit dieser Option legen Sie fest, ob die Ausführung des Skriptes innerhalb einer Transaktion mit anschließendem Rollback erfolgt oder ob das Skript direkt gegen die Datenbank ausgeführt wird.
-
Wählen Sie Start.
Die Ausführung des Skriptes wird gestartet. Nach Ausführung eines Skriptes werden das Ergebnis und die Ausführungszeit des Skriptes angezeigt.
TIPP: Um Skripte leichter zu finden, können Sie im Bereich Skripte die folgenden Funktionen nutzen.
-
Um Skripte zu filtern, geben Sie im Eingabefeld Skript suchen die Zeichenkette ein, nach der gefiltert werden soll.
-
Geänderte Skripte werden im System Debugger mit einem * gekennzeichnet.
-
Um alle geänderten Skripte zu finden, klicken Sie auf und verwenden Sie im Menü den Eintrag Geänderte Skripte.
Verwandte Themen
Bildungsregeln und Formatierungsskripte im System Debugger testen
Um eine Bildungsregel zu testen
-
Wählen Sie im System Debugger im Bereich Bildungsregeln die Spalte mit Bildungsregel aus.
-
Wählen Sie unter Datenspalte für Bildungsregel, die Spalte deren Bildungsregel Sie testen.
-
Wählen Sie unter Datenbankobjekt das Objekt, auf welches die Bildungsregel angewendet werden soll.
-
Prüfen Sie die Option Transaktion mit Rollback für die Ausführung der Bildungsregel.
Mit dieser Option legen Sie fest, ob die Ausführung der Bildungsregel innerhalb einer Transaktion mit anschließendem Rollback erfolgt oder ob die Bildungsregel direkt gegen die Datenbank ausgeführt wird.
-
Wählen Sie eine der folgenden Aktionen zum Testen der Bildungsregel.
Speichern |
Das Objekt wird gespeichert. |
Verwerfen |
Die Änderungen am Objekt werden verworfen. |
Laden |
Das Objekt wird erneut geladen. |
Neu |
Ein neues Objekt wird erzeugt. |
Ausführen |
Die Bildungsregel wird erneut ausgeführt. |
Um ein Formatierungsskript zu testen
-
Wählen Sie im System Debugger im Bereich Formate die Spalte mit Formatierungsskript aus.
-
Wählen Sie unter Datenbankobjekt das Objekt, auf welches das Formatierungsskript angewendet werden soll.
Verwandte Themen